Job Duties may require a split shift, such as 5:30 to 9:30AM and 4:00 to 8:00 PM Lifting requirement of 100 lbs General Farm Workwill include the following responsibilities: maintain, drive, attach andoperate farm implements/tractors/equipment to till soil, plant,cultivate, fertilize and harvest crops; make minor mechanicaladjustments and repairs on farm machinery; may mix and/or spraychemicals (according to appropriate restrictive use laws, when/ifapplicable); remove undesirable and excess growth from crops or farmgrounds; remove rocks from field; paint farm structures; replace/repairfencing; perform general clean up of farm areas; drive, load/unloadtrucks; operate motor bike or all-terrain vehicle in the course ofperforming duties. Irrigation duties will include the following: Handlines: connect pipes; check alignment of pipe and adjust for properwater distribution; attach lines to water supply; turn on pump; turnvalves to start flow of water; disassemble lines and carry pipes acrossfields at specified intervals; move pipes through freshly irrigatedcrops and/or plowed fields where mud may be deep at times; lift andcarry pipe sections weighing approximately 40 pounds on a sustainedbasis. Wheel lines: start gasoline engines and operate controls to movelines across fields at specified intervals; align lines and roll back tobegin rotation again. Pivots: push on switch that activates circlesprinkler system. Flood Irrigation: lift gate in side of floodedirrigation ditch/pipe permitting water to flow into bordered section offield; shovel and pack dirt in low spots of embankment or cut trenchesin high areas to direct water flow; close gate in ditch/pipe whenbordered section is flooded; open gate or connect pipe to undergroundpipe system that releases water flow into reservoir or ditch; siphonwater from flooded reservoir or ditch to channel water into designatedareas; shovel or hoe soil to clear ditches/furrows and build embankmentsto appropriately channel water; mix and apply proper solutions to fillholes/cracks in pipes, ditches, and spillways, and make minor repairs tometal, concrete, and wooden frameworks in pipe and ditch valves andgates. Other Irrigation Duties: remove pipes/wheel lines from storageand lay out/place in predetermined patterns in fields; lubricate,adjust, repair and replace parts such as sprinkler heads and drivechains using hand tools; observe revolving sprinklers and adjust toensure proper operation and uniform distribution of water; disassemble,service and store pipes/mainlines/wheel lines after irrigation season.To meet minimum acceptable performance standards when irrigating, theworker must, after a 10 day conditioning period, move an average of atleast 48 40-foot sections of 3-inch pipe or 44 40-foot sections of4-inch pipe per hour under normal working conditions. Duties related tothe Harvesting of Potatoes/Sugar Beets will include the following: Willapply techniques as instructed by the employer to: remove rocks fromrows in front of harvesting equipment; discard diseased/rotting product,rocks and foreign matter; alert equipment operator of equipmentclogging/malfunctions; aid operator in correct machine performance.
